Montessori Teacher, Preschool: A Meaningful Career Choice

Working as a Montessori teacher in a preschool means playing a crucial role in the early development of children. The Montessori pedagogy, founded by Maria Montessori, focuses on creating a learning environment where children can explore and learn at their own pace. As a Montessori teacher, you work to create a stimulating environment that promotes independence, creativity, and critical thinking in children.

Salary Statistics for Montessori Teachers, Preschool

The average salary for Montessori teachers at the preschool level is 34 600 SEK per month. There is a salary difference between genders; men earn an average of 32 400 SEK while women earn 34 700 SEK. This means that women earn 107% of what men do in this profession. Compared to the previous measurement, the average salary has increased from 33 600 to 34 600 SEK.

Education and Requirements to Become a Montessori Teacher

To become a Montessori teacher in a preschool, you need to have a preschool teacher degree, which usually involves a three-year university education. In addition to this, a specialization in Montessori pedagogy is often necessary. This specialization can be obtained through various courses and certification programs offered by Montessori associations and educational institutions.

Job Market and Employment Opportunities

The demand for Montessori teachers is generally good, especially in larger cities and areas with many independent schools. Montessori pedagogy has gained ground in Sweden, and there is a growing number of Montessori preschools seeking qualified teachers. Having a Montessori certification can be a strong asset and increase the chances of getting hired.

Job Duties and Responsibilities

As a Montessori teacher, you are responsible for planning and implementing education according to the principles of Montessori pedagogy. This includes creating a learning environment adapted to the children's needs and interests, observing and documenting their development, and collaborating with colleagues and parents. Tasks may also involve organizing and participating in various activities and events that promote children's learning and social development.

Skills and Qualities

To thrive and be successful as a Montessori teacher, it is important to have a strong pedagogical ability and a genuine interest in children's development. Other important qualities include patience, creativity, good communication skills, the ability to work independently and in a team. A Montessori teacher should also be flexible and adaptable to meet the individual needs and interests of the children.

Who has the highest salary?
The highest salary for a Montessori teacher, preschool is 39700 kr. This salary belongs to a woman working in the Government sector with a postgraduate education. The highest salary for a man in this profession is 36100 kr.
Who has the lowest salary?
The lowest salary for a Montessori teacher, preschool is 23000 kr. This salary belongs to a woman also working in the Government sector. The lowest salary for a man in this profession is 23300 kr.
Salary distributed by age and sector
Age Women's salary as a percentage of men's Base salary Monthly salary
18-24 108% 25000 kr 25000 kr
25-34 103% 33200 kr 33300 kr
35-44 102% 33800 kr 33800 kr
45-54 106% 36000 kr 36100 kr
55-64 109% 36300 kr 36300 kr
65-68 36100 kr 36100 kr
Snitt 107% 34500 kr 34600 kr

About the data

All information displayed on this page is based on data from the Swedish Central Bureau of Statistics (SCB), the Swedish Tax Agency and the Swedish employment agency. Learn more about our data and data sources here.

All figures are gross salaries, meaning salaries before tax. The average salary, or mean salary, is calculated by adding up the total salary for all individuals within the profession and dividing it by the number of individuals. For specific job categories, we have also considered various criteria such as experience and education.

Profession Montessori teacher, preschool has the SSYK code 2343, which we use to match against the SCB database to obtain the latest salary statistics.
